2 1. Image Formats To store an image, the image is represented in a two dimensional matrix of pixels. Information about each pixel has to be stored. Additional information may be associated to the image as a whole, such as height and width, depth. The most popular image storing formats include PostScript, GIF (Graphics Interchange Format), JPEG, PNG, TIFF (Tagged Image File Format), BMP (Bitmap), etc. Slide: 2

GIF GIF stands for Graphic Interchange Format GIF87a first format of GIF used on the Web was called, representing its year and version. savesimagesat8pits per pixel (256 colors) by using a color loop up table (color palette). lossless file compression format (i.e. all image information retained). GIF89a format updated in 1989 to include transparency, interlacing and animation. GIF89a Transparency Transparency allows for the specification of one of the colors in the palette to be ignored while processing the image for your display device. GIF89a Interlacing Interlacing lines are stored in an unusual order: the first pass has pixel rows 1, 9, 17, etc (every eighth row); the second pass has rows 5, 13, 21, etc (every remaining fourth row); the third pass has rows 3, 7, 11, 15, etc (every remaining odd row); and the last pass has rows 2, 4, 6, etc (all the even numbered rows). allows the user to get a good idea what is coming up, so they don't have to wait until the whole image is downloaded images don't really load any faster, they just seem to. 9 4. GIF89a Animation Animation GIF89a specification added a few enhancements to the GIF file header which allows browsers to display multiple GIF images in a timed and/or looped sequence. Slide: 9

10 5. JPEG, JPG JPEG stands for Joint Photographic Experts Group. Saves image in 24 bit color, images can have 16,777,216 colors Best for photo quality images No animation No transparency Lossy image compression format Progressive JPEG Similar to interlaced GIF Image is transmitted and displayed in a sequence of overlays, with each overlay becoming progressively higher in quality. 12 7. JPEG Quality vs Size The chart below shows the relationships between image quality and the compression ratio. A small amount of compression has a negligible effect on the image quality, yet a substantial effect on file size. Slide: 12

13 8. JPEG Compression Requirements on JPEG implementations JPEG Image Preparation Blocks, Minimum Coded Units (MCU) JPEG Image Processing Discrete Cosine Transformation (DCT) JPEG Quantization Quantization Tables JPEG Entropy Encoding Run length Coding/Huffman Encoding Slide: 13

14 9. Variants of Image Compression Four different modes Lossy Sequential DCT based mode Baseline process that must be supported by every JPEG implementation. Expanded Lossy DCT based mode enhancements to baseline process Lossless mode low compression ratio allows perfect reconstruction of original image Hierarchical mode accommodates images of different resolutions Slide: 14

15 10. JPEG2000 Designed to overcome the limitations of the original JPEG standard and provide high quality images at low bit rates. Advantages Over JPEG Better image quality at the same file size Good image quality even at very high compression ratios, over 80:1 Large Images: JPEG is restricted to 64kx64k images. JPEG2000 will handle image sizes up to (2 32 1) Support both lossless and lossy compression Handle up to 256 channels of information Improved error resilience Compound document can include non image data as part of the file Slide: 15

18 11. PNG Stands for Portable Network Graphic. Designed to replace GIF. Features: Lossless compression Support for up to 48 bit color information Varying levels of transparency Gamma correction Better compression, percent smaller files than GIF Interlacing Patent free compression algorithm Slide: 18

21 14. JPEG vs GIF Is JPEG always better than GIF? JPEG is good for photo image compression. For cartoon and B/W images, GIF always performs much better. 24 bit BMP JPEG GIF 363 KB 23 KB 6 KB Slide: 21

22 15. Which image should be used? Small images, like icons and buttons: GIF or PNG Line art, grayscale (black and white), cartoons: GIF or PNG 24 bit color depth lossless Image: PNG, JPG2000 Scanned images and photographs: JPEG Large images or images with a lot of detail: JPEG Slide: 22

Other Formats TIFF Tagged Image File Format (TIFF), stores many different types of images (e.g., monochrome, grayscale, 8 bit & 24 bit RGB,etc.) > tagged Developed in the 1980 s TIFF is a lossless format It does not provide any major advantages over JPEG and is not as user controllable It appears to be declining in popularity EXIF EXIF (Exchange Image File) is an image format for digital cameras: Compressed EXIF files use the baseline JPEG format. A variety of tags are available to facilitate higher quality printing, since information about the camera and picture taking conditions (flash, exposure, white balance, etc.) can be stored. The EXIF standard also includes specification of file format for audio that accompanies digital images. Slide: 23

24 PS and PDF Postscript is an important language for typesetting, and many high end printers have a Postscript interpreter built into them. Postscript is a vector based picture language, rather than pixel based: page element definitions are essentially in terms of vectors. Postscript includes text as well as vector/structured graphics. GL bit mapped images can be included in output files. Encapsulated Postscript files add some additional information for inclusion of Postscript files in another document. Postscript page description language itself does not provide compression; in fact, Postscript files are just stored as ASCII. Another text + figures language has begun to supersede or at least parallel Postscript: Adobe Systems Inc. includes LZW compression in its Portable Document Format (PDF) file format. PDF files that do not include images have about the same compression ratio, 2:1 or 3:1, as do files compressed with other LZW based compression tools. Slide: 24

Some Other JPEG Formats Microsoft Windows: BMP Major system standard graphics file format for Microsoft Windows, used in Microsoft Paint and other programs Many sub variants within the BMP standard Microsoft Windows: WMF (WindowsMetafile) Native vector file format for the Windows operating environment: Features 1. Consist of a collection of GDI (Graphics Device Interface) function calls, also native to the Windows environment. e.g., PlayMetaFile() function to render 2. Ostensibly device independent and size unlimited Macintosh: PAINT and PICT: PAINT was originally used in the MacPaint program, initially only for 1 bit monochrome images PICT format is used in MacDraw (a vector based drawing program) for storing structured graphics. Unix X windows: PPM (Portable Pixmap) Supports 24 bit color bitmaps, and can be manipulated using many public domain graphic editors, e.g., xv. Adobe Photoshop: PSD Much more...
